Place in Herat Province, Afghanistan From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Kushk or Koshk is a town in Afghanistan[1] that shares its name with the Kushk River which flows by the town. It is the center of Kushk District, Herat Province. The population is 17,479. It is located at 33.29565°N 61.952206°E at 1068 m altitude
